Methods and systems for augmented reality display with dynamic field of view

    Abstract: A method of operating a dynamic eyepiece in an augmented reality headset includes producing first virtual content associated with a first depth plane, coupling the first virtual content into the dynamic eyepiece, and projecting the first virtual content through one or more waveguide layers of the dynamic eyepiece to an eye of a viewer. The one or more waveguide layers are characterized by a first surface profile. The method also includes modifying the one or more waveguide layers to be characterized by a second surface profile different from the first surface profile, producing second virtual content associated with a second depth plane, coupling the second virtual content into the dynamic eyepiece, and projecting the second virtual content through the one or more waveguide layers of the dynamic eyepiece to the eye of the viewer.

    Abstract: An annular axial flux motor includes a rotor mounted on an annular subsection of a rotatable cam ring and a stator mounted on an annular subsection of a carrier frame. The rotor includes two Halbach arrays of permanent magnets spaced from each other on the cam ring along an axial direction. The stator includes multiple phase electrical windings printed on multiple layers of a printed circuit board (PCB) that are stacked along the axial direction. The multiple layers are positioned between the Halbach arrays, with active side of the Halbach arrays facing to opposite sides of the multiple layers. The Halbach arrays are configured to generate a symmetrical magnetic field and the multiple phase electrical windings are configured to have a same rotor-dependent torque constant, such that the stator can generate a constant torque to rotate the rotor and the cam ring within a finite travel range.

    Abstract: An example head-mounted display device includes a light projector, an optical assembly arranged to direct light from a light projector to a user, and an actuator module. The optical assembly includes a variable focus lens assembly including a rigid refractive component, a shaper ring defining an aperture, and a flexible lens membrane between the shaper ring and the rigid refractive component and covering the aperture. The refractive component, the shaper ring, and the lens membrane are arranged along an axis. The refractive component and the lens membrane define a chamber containing a volume of fluid. The actuator module is configured to adjust an optical power of the variable focus lens by moving the shaper ring relative to the refractive component along the axis, such that a curvature of the lens membrane in the aperture is modified.

    Abstract: A dynamic eyepiece for projecting an image to an eye of a viewer includes a waveguide layer having an input surface, an output surface opposing the input surface, and a periphery. The waveguide layer is configured to propagate light therein. The dynamic eyepiece also includes a mechanical structure coupled to at least a portion of the periphery of the waveguide layer. The mechanical structure is operable to apply a first mechanical force to the at least a portion of the periphery of the waveguide layer to impose a first surface profile on the output surface of the waveguide layer and apply a second mechanical force to the at least a portion of the periphery of the waveguide layer to impose a second surface profile different from the first surface profile on the output surface of the waveguide layer.
